Zemple, MN Demographics
A map of Zemple's Population by Race
Zemple, Minnesota has an estimated population of 49, a dramatic decrease from the 78 recorded in the 2020 Census. The population is 65.3% White, 32.7% Multiracial, 2.0% Native American/Other, 0.0% Black, 0.0% Asian, and 0.0% Hispanic. This demographic dot map shows the population of Zemple, with one dot drawn for each person counted by the Census, color-coded by race.
Zemple has become considerably more racially diverse since the 2020 Census. It is considerably more diverse than Minnesota overall. Demographers use a diversity index to measure the probability that two randomly selected individuals belong to different racial or ethnic groups. In Zemple, that probability was 29.4% in 2020 and 46.7% in the most recent ACS estimates.
Zemple is ranked the 859th most populous place in Minnesota, out of 915 places.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s). Zemple was ranked the 829th most populous place in the 2020 Census.

Zemple's Multiracial Population
16 residents of Zemple, or 32.7% of the population, identify as Multiracial. The share of Multiracial residents in Zemple is significantly higher than in Minnesota overall, where 4.5% of the population is Multiracial. Zemple ranks 32nd statewide in terms of Multiracial residents as a share of the population, out of 915 places.
Since the 2020 Census, Zemple's Multiracial population has grown by an estimated 128.6%. Multiracial residents' share of Zemple's population has increased from 9.0% to 32.7%.
Zemple is more Multiracial than neighboring Deer River (9% Multiracial), Ball Club (4.7% Multiracial), Cohasset (4.1% Multiracial), Grand Rapids (4.7% Multiracial), and Remer (7.8% Multiracial).
